WebThe gets function is a built-in function that is used to read the characters from the console and store that in a string. It reads the characters till a new line is found or EOF is reached, whichever comes first. Syntax: char *gets(char * str) str is the pointer in which the character read is stored. WebThe execution of a C program begins from the main () function. When the compiler encounters functionName ();, control of the program jumps to void functionName () And, the compiler starts executing the codes inside functionName (). The control of the program jumps back to the main () function once code inside the function definition is executed. WebThe number of apples must be even The number of bananas must be a multiple of 5. 0 WebIn C programming language, getc and putc methods are used for reading and writing contents from a file. We can use these functions to read a character from a file or write a character to a file. In this post, we will learn how to use getc and putc methods with definitions and examples. getc (): getc is defined as like below: int getc(FILE *f)

Lab Manual costco home buying programWeb4 Mar 2024 · getch () is a nonstandard function and is present in conio.h header file which is mostly used by MS-DOS compilers like Turbo C. It is not part of the C standard library or ISO C, nor is it defined by POSIX.
